LET THE INTERNET HELP YOU CHOOSE
THE RIGHT NURSING HOME
The most frequently asked question during my meetings with families facing nursing home care for a family member is: “Will we have to spend everything we have at the nursing home?” Once I have assured them that most of their assets can be saved for their spouse or family, the question then becomes: “How do we choose the right nursing home?”
The first factor to consider in selecting a nursing home is location. The closer the family is to the nursing home, the more they will visit. You should visit the nursing homes close to your family during scheduled and unscheduled times to observe the facility, the staff, and the patients. You should speak with family members of several residents and ask them pointed questions about the care their family member receives.
I also recommend you visit the Medicare web page at www.medicare.gov. On the bottom of the page, click on the words “Compare Nursing Homes in Your Area.” Your can also download an excellent publication entitled “Guide To Choosing a Nursing Home,” by clicking on the tabs “Resources,” then “Nursing Home Publications.” If you do not have access to the Internet, you can order this publication by calling 1-800-MEDICARE (1-800-633-4227) and order publication #02174 for free!
You can quickly obtain detailed information about every nursing home in the United States. You can select certain nursing homes and compare information about ownership, medical condition of their residents in general, summaries of their last inspection, and information about the education level of their staff.
There are 509 nursing homes in the State of Indiana. You can obtain detailed information about each nursing home and how they compare to the other nursing homes in a particular city or county.
